About flea and worming treatment

Regular flea and worming treatment protects pets from common parasites that can cause discomfort and, in some cases, transmit disease. The right product and frequency depend on your pet’s age, weight and lifestyle.

Practices can recommend vet-strength preventive treatments and the correct dosing schedule. Some wellness plans include year-round parasite protection.

How often should I treat for fleas and worms?

It depends on the product and your pet’s risk — some treatments are monthly, others every three months. Your vet will recommend a schedule.

Are vet treatments better than shop-bought ones?

Vet-prescribed products are dosed to your pet’s weight and target the parasites most relevant to them. A vet can advise what’s most suitable.
